8 The Consignment was intercepted by the Air Intelligence Unit of the Office of the Commissioner of Customs at Sahar Airport on 11 th February 2009 even before it reached SEEPZ. The Consignment was examined on 16th February 2009 and the same was detained by respondent no.3. Petitioner's representative one Mr. Dilip Joshi was questioned and his statements were recorded (under Section 108 of the Customs Act) on Gauri Gaekwad 12/57 WP-2003-2009.doc 4th March 2009, 5th March 2009, 18th March 2009, 24th March 2009 and 25th March 2009 ('the statements'). The statements, inter alia, clarified the purpose of import of the Consignment, i.e., for remaking of jewellery, which was permitted. It was also explained that the jewellery in the Consignment was purchased as a raw material wherein they melt the product and used the recovered material for manufacture of jewellery. Pertinently, the statements recorded that the goods forming a part of the Consignment were manufactured in petitioner's unit at the SEZ and the same were exported earlier by petitioner between 28th April 2008 and 1st November 2008 and further the designs also pertain to petitioner.
